[Python] [Windows] Speichern Sie einen Screenshot als Bild

zunaechst

Ich musste einen Screenshot des erweiterten Bildschirms speichern, also schrieb ich ihn einfach.

Politik

    1. Apropos Sukusho, drücken Sie die PrtSc-Taste (PyAutoGUI)
  1. Speichern Sie den Inhalt der Zwischenablage (PIL)

prtsc.py


import pyautogui
from PIL import ImageGrab

#Geben Sie den Speicherort und den Dateinamen an, die Sie speichern möchten
fo = r"C:\Users\hoge\Pictures\Screenshots\desktop.png "

pyautogui.press('printscreen')

im = ImageGrab.grabclipboard()
im.save(fo)

Ergänzung

Bitte googeln Sie, um PyAutoGUI und PIL Ihres Moduls zu installieren. Ich erinnere mich nicht ...

Recommended Posts

[Python] [Windows] Speichern Sie einen Screenshot als Bild
Erstellen Sie eine Umgebung mit 64-Bit-Windows + Python 2.7 + MeCab 0.996
Beschneiden Sie Numpy.ndarray und speichern Sie es als Bild
Die Geschichte, ein Tool zum Laden von Bildern mit Python zu erstellen ⇒ Speichern unter
Speichern Sie das Eingangsvideo von der Aufnahmekarte als Bild
Verstehen Sie die Funktion der Faltung am Beispiel der Bildverarbeitung
Schneiden Sie ein Bild mit Python aus
Bilderfassung von Firefox mit Python
Graustufenbild und als CSV speichern
Format, wenn eine lange Zeichenfolge als Python-Argument übergeben wird
Extrahieren Sie Feature-Punkte eines Bildes
Ideone> Python-Version: 3.5 (Stand 29. August 2017)
Sende Bild mit Python und speichere mit PHP
[Python] Grund für den Typ "int32" in Numpy (Windows-Umgebung) (Stand September 2020)
Python: Grundlagen der Bilderkennung mit CNN
Python: Anwendung der Bilderkennung mit CNN
Gemeinsamer Bildschirm mit Python Exe App
[Python] [Windows] Machen Sie eine Bildschirmaufnahme mit Python
[Python] Berechnung der Bildähnlichkeit (Würfelkoeffizient)
Graustufen durch Matrix-Reinventor der Python-Bildverarbeitung-
Zeichnen mit Matrix-Reinventor von Python Image Processing-
Analyse des Röntgenmikrotomographiebildes durch Python
Faltungsfilterung durch Matrix-Reinventor der Python-Bildverarbeitung-
Python> Funktion> Beispiel für die Übernahme der Funktion als Argument> Karte (Lambda x: 2 ** x, [1, 2, 3]) / local () ['myprint'] (3.1415, 2.718)
Speichern Sie automatisch Bilder Ihrer Lieblingsfiguren aus der Google Bildsuche mit Python
Beispiel für die Verwendung von Python> function> * args als Argument
Maschinelles Lernen des Sports - Analyse der J-League als Beispiel - ②
So beschneiden Sie ein Bild mit Python + OpenCV
Bildverarbeitung? Die Geschichte, Python für zu starten
Bildverarbeitung mit Python Environment Setup für Windows
Erstellen Sie ein Bild mit Zeichen mit Python (Japanisch)
[Python] Generiert automatisch ein Beispielbild für eine Animationsliste.
[Python + OpenCV] Malen Sie den transparenten Teil des Bildes weiß
Hinweis: Bedeutung der Angabe von nur * (Sternchen) als Argument in der Funktionsdefinition von Python
Nehmen Sie eine Instanz einer Python-Ausnahmeklasse nicht direkt als Argument für die Ausnahmeklasse!
[Python] Speichern Sie das Ergebnis des Web-Scrapings der Mercari-Produktseite in Google Colab in einer Google-Tabelle und zeigen Sie auch das Produktbild an.